3. Compliance Challenges of Cross-Chain Transactions

  • Lack of a legal framework
  • Although many countries and regions have gradually established cryptocurrency regulatory policies, the legal framework for cross-chain transactions remains inadequate. This exposes users to compliance risks when conducting cross-chain transactions, which may involve issues such as money laundering and terrorist financing.

  • 反洗钱(AML)和客户识别(KYC)
  • Many regions have implemented anti-money laundering (AML) and know-your-customer (KYC) policies for cryptocurrency exchanges and wallets, but these measures are difficult to effectively enforce in cross-chain transactions. How to ensure compliance with AML and KYC requirements in the design of cross-chain transactions in Bitpie Wallet has become an urgent issue that needs to be addressed.

  • Tax issues

    There are still no clear regulations regarding the taxation of cross-chain transactions, which may make it difficult for users to determine tax compliance during such transactions. Users need to have a clear understanding of the potential tax consequences of cross-chain transactions to avoid facing penalties due to lack of awareness.

  • Education and User Awareness
  • Users have varying levels of understanding regarding cryptocurrencies and blockchain technology. Many users lack compliance awareness when conducting cross-chain transactions, making them susceptible to pitfalls. Therefore, improving users' compliance awareness and education is also an important task.

    3. Practical Tips for Enhancing Compliance

    When facing these compliance challenges, users can adopt the following specific productivity-boosting tips to help ensure the compliance of their cross-chain transactions.

    Tip 1: Research local laws and regulations

    Before conducting cross-chain transactions, users should take the time to research the cryptocurrency-related laws and regulations in their country or region. For example, they should understand the legal provisions regarding cross-chain transactions, whether registration is required, and whether specific licenses need to be obtained. This can effectively help avoid legal risks.

    Tip 2: Use a compliant wallet

    Choose wallets that place a high emphasis on compliance. For example, users can select wallets with a good reputation that actively cooperate with regulatory requirements. Bitpie Wallet has good practices in this regard, providing relevant compliance audits and transparency reports.

    Tip 3: Conduct thorough KYC and AML checks

    When conducting cross-chain transactions with the Bitpie wallet, you should ensure that you have completed sufficient KYC and AML checks, providing authentic identity information and sources of funds. This is not only for compliance, but also an important measure to enhance transaction security.

    Tip 4: Keep Transaction Records

    When conducting cross-chain transactions, users should keep detailed transaction records, including the transaction time, amount, counterparty, and other relevant information. This can be provided to tax authorities or regulatory agencies when necessary to ensure compliance.

    Tip 5: Continuously Monitor Policy Changes

    Regulatory policies for cryptocurrencies are constantly evolving, so users need to stay updated on relevant policy trends in order to adjust their trading strategies and compliance measures. Regularly consulting reliable legal information platforms can enhance users' compliance capabilities.

    Frequently Asked Questions

    Question 1: Is cross-chain trading on Bitpie Wallet safe?

    Bitpie Wallet adopts multiple security measures, including the separation of hot and cold wallets and private key management. Nevertheless, users still need to follow compliance measures to ensure the security of their own information and funds.

    Question 2: How to ensure the compliance of cross-chain transactions?

    Users should refer to the laws and regulations of their region to ensure that cross-chain transactions comply with local regulatory requirements. Professional legal advice may be sought if necessary.

    Question 3: Is it necessary to pay taxes on cross-chain transactions?

    Different countries and regions have varying policies regarding cryptocurrency taxation. Generally speaking, cross-chain transactions may involve capital gains tax and other related tax issues, which should be confirmed with the local tax authorities.
